Postcode SE17 2TN is located in a major urban area, within the North Walworth ward of Southwark in the London region, and forms part of the Walworth South area. It has high deprivation and very high crime levels, with around 153.2 crimes per 1,000 residents per year, roughly 1.2× the London average of 130 per 1,000. The average income per household in Walworth South is £58,614 per year. The nearest station is Elephant and Castle, about 0.5 miles away. There are 13 primary and 4 secondary schools in the area. There are 10 parks nearby, the closest large park is Burgess Park.
Walworth South has a high level of deprivation, ranked at position 8,204 out of 32,844 areas in the United Kingdom, placing it within the top 25% most deprived areas in England.
Walworth South has a very high crime rate, with approximately 153.2 reported incidents per 1,000 population each year.
Approximately 77.7% of homes on this street are social housing provided by a local council or housing association. Across the surrounding area, around 58.8% of dwellings are socially rented.
The average income per household in Walworth South is £58,614 per year.
No significant noise sources from railways or roads near SE17 2TN.
Walworth South near SE17 2TN has no flood risk (less than 0.1% chance of a flood each year) from rivers and sea.
